Proc freq in sas pdf procedure

The sas proc freq procedure prints all values of a given. The freq procedure, you can use the ods proclabel statement. For example, below is a frequency table for the variable make. The freq procedure produces oneway to nway frequency and contingency crosstabulation tables.

Guidos guide to proc freq a tutorial for beginners. Guido, university of rochester medical center, rochester, ny. Proc freq on multiple variables combined into one table. The freq procedure overview the freq procedure produces oneway to nway frequency and crosstabulation contingency tables. I dont want to have to type out proc freq for each variable like this. Proc freq is commonly used procedure to summarize data and calculate statistics, but the preloadfmt option is not supported. We have made a twoway table with a threelevel categorical variable ses and a twolevel categorical variable female. The path less trodden proc freq for odds ratio, continued 4. You can then read that value by using a sas program. It is common for an analysis to involve a procedure run separately for groups within a dataset or for a list of variables. Frequency tables using proc freq sas tutorials libguides at. Remember that you do not want to use a continuous variable in a proc freq, because each value of the variable will be used and the output can get to be very long. The freq procedure the freq procedure prints all values of a given categorical variable in the output window, along with the. If you are willing to step away from proc freq you can achieve the required output using proc tabulate.

For nway tables, proc freq provides stratified analysis by computing statistics within strata and across strata for oneway frequency tables, proc freq provides goodnessoffit tests for equal proportions or specified null. In this chapter we will take a closer look at procedure steps which allow us to call a sas procedure to analyse or process a. The crosstabulation template for proc freq is a template procedure that. In order to simulate the preloadfmt option in a proc freq, for example.

For twoway tables, proc freq computes tests and measures of association. Descriptions of the options follow in alphabetical order. The proc freq statement invokes the procedure and optionally identifies the input data set. Note that there is a sasstat procedure called proc pls, which employs the partial least squares technique but for a different class of models than those of proc calis. The objective of this paper is to present some of the common utilities of proc freq. Replacing row, column, and table headings by default, proc freq creates a table with specific row, column, and table headings, as shown in this example. The proc freq statement invokes the freq procedure. Carpenter california occidental consultants abstract the meanssummary procedure is a workhorse for most data analysts. How can i generate pdf and html files for my sas output. How to hide the freq procedure default title posted.

Proc freq uses ods graphics to create graphs as part of its output. Freq procedure frequency tables and statistics the freq procedure provides easy access to statistics for testing for association in a crosstabulation table. The proc freq is one of the most frequently used sas procedures which helps to summarize categorical variable. Ods enables you to convert any of the output from proc freq into a sas data set. You can change the text of this node, but you cannot eliminate the node. If you specify the following statements, proc freq produces a oneway frequency table for each variable in the most recently created data set.

If you use the freq statement, the procedure assumes that each observation represents n observations. For general information about ods graphics, see chapter 21, statistical graphics using ods. You may noticed that, when we run any sas procedure like freq, means etc. This example combines output to a sas data set, merging outputs from 3 regressions to build a compound table that is output to an rtf file. Below we show the sas code and the output for proc freq we have used the hsb2 data set. In this article, we will show you 7 different ways to analyze your data using the freq procedure. The proc freq statement is the only required statement for the freq procedure.

The procedure of sign test and sas implementation weixing song i. If you just want a onetime change, then an easier alternative is to output the table from proc freq to a sas data set and then use proc print. You can control the style and attributes of the output, thus creating a customized report. Using mlf with orderfreq might not produce the order that you expect for the formatted values. For more information about creating accessible tables with proc tabulate, see creating accessible tables with the tabulate procedure in creating accessible sas. The version 9 sas procedure manual states, the freq procedure produces oneway to nway frequency and cross tabulation contingency tables. The npar1way procedure overview the npar1way procedure performs nonparametric tests for location and scale differences across a oneway classi. For general path analysis with latent variables, consider using proc calis. How to hide the freq procedure default title all abt. Sas frequency distribution using sas proc freq dataflair.

Introduction the name alone might lead anyone to think that primary use of proc freq is to generate tables of frequencies. Procedure gives a list of ods table names and contents. Proc means and proc univariate marjorie smith, cereal research centre. I tend to just use it for proc freq output but know that it can work. The ods output destination enables you to store any value that is produced by any sas procedure. As always with sas there are multiple paths to the desirred result. By default, the tables statement used with proc freq will output a table. Proc freq is a procedure that is widely used among sas users and this paper establishes that it does not only provide crosstabulation tables but is a powerful procedure that can. Proc tabulate also provides the ability to add captions to tables. The freq procedure can generate oneway to nway frequency and contingency tables along with various statistical measures of interest. See the section ods table names on page 2935 for more information. Formatting characters used by proc freq shows the formatting characters that proc freq uses. Seeing the freq procedures oneway tables in a new light 4.

In addition to using the basic syntax shown above proc freq data colleges. Es sind beliebig viele tablesstatements in einer proc freq moglich. Proc freq uses the output delivery system ods, a sas subsystem that provides capabilities for displaying and controlling the output from sas procedures. In the previous chapter we were introduced to some very basic aspects of sas. If you use the freq statement, then the procedure assumes that each observation represents n observations, where n is the value of variable. Omitting positions, is the same as specifying all 20 possible sas formatting characters, in order. Proc npar1way also provides a standard analysis of variance on the raw data and statistics based on the empirical distribution function. These first several examples will use a dataset called. For example, gender is a categorical variable having two categories male and. In this tutorial, we will show how to use the sas procedure proc freq to create frequency tables that summarize individual categorical variables. Words in all caps are sas keywords words in lower case are things you specify words in proc freq uses ods graphics to create graphs as part of its output.

Accessibletable changes the layout of some tables to make them accessible and adds visual captions to tables. Here are a couple of example to help you quickly put it to use. This provides a simpler and more concise solution and does not require digging through the long and often confusing proc template documents. I want to run proc freq on all of the variables in large database and output a table of the results for each variable. Posted 04062017 6707 views this should be pretty much straightforward but i cant get it work even after reading through the documentation. Saving results from sas proc freq with multiple tables. By default, the procedure uses the most recently created sas data set. If you specify the missing option in the proc statement, then the procedure considers missing values as valid levels for the combination of class.

The freq procedure prints all values of a given categorical variable in the output. Simulate preloadfmt option in proc freq ajay gupta, ppd, morrisville, nc. Guidos guide to proc freq a tutorial for beginners using the sas system. By default, sas returns a very comprehensive amount of information in the output from its procedures. See the section ods table names on page 1795 for more information. Proc freq is an essential procedure within base sas used primarily for counting, displaying and analyzing categorical type data. Replacing the row, column, and table variables with variable.

172 1174 470 1234 708 1078 802 937 1344 1120 1048 1088 1508 463 674 212 41 1200 1040 711 122 1254 865 1373 151 615 1060 166 277 775 1163 1056 137 184